Description
Summary:The purpose of the study was to examine the safety of combination of basil, turmeric and bean sprouts extract solution on the hematological parameters and blood biochemistry profile of rats. The combined ingredients used in the study were obtained from different places. A total of 15 rats were divided into 3 groups based on the treatment dose. Each group consisted of 5 rats. The rats in control group (K) did not given extract combination, while the rats in group KKT 1 % and KKT 5% received combination of basil, turmeric and bean sprouts extract at dose of 1% and 5%, respectively. Effectiveness and safety tests were carried out by evaluating the hematological and blood biochemical profiles of female rats. The data were analyzed using one-way analysis of variance (ANOVA). The results showed that the rats given combination of basil, turmeric and bean sprouts extract at a dose of 1% and, dose of 5% did not had significant different compared to control (P0.05), but tend to have positive effects in increasing  several blood components that play an important role in maintaining immunity during pregnancy. It can be concluded that the combination of basil, turmeric and bean sprouts at dose of 1% and 5% do not adversely affect hematology profile and blood biochemistry of rats. This indicates that the extract combination does not cause any toxicity effects on the rats.
